Fatebringer is an Outlaw rogue artifact trait. It is linked to the [Fate's Thirst], [Hidden Blade] and [Ghostly Shell] traits.
Patch changes
- Patch 8.0.1 (2018-07-17): Removed.
- Patch 7.2.0 (2017-03-28): Fatebringer (Artifact talent) now reduces the Energy cost of Finishing moves by 1 per point (was a reduction of 2 Energy per point).
- Patch 7.1.5 (2017-01-10): Now reduces energy cost by 2/4/6 (was 3/6/9).
- Hotfix (2016-09-23): Fatebringer (Artifact Trait) Energy cost reduction reduced to 3 per rank.
- Patch 7.0.3 (2016-07-19): Added.
